
Domain Rating is a third-party score on a 0 to 100 scale that estimates how strong your site’s backlink profile is. It is popular because it is fast to compare and easy to sort by. Pitch a guest article, apply for a partner directory, or reach out to a publisher and you will often be judged by DR before anyone reads your content.
The tricky part is separating actions that actually move DR from busywork. You do not need gimmicks. You need new, relevant referring domains, content worth citing, and a site that passes link equity cleanly. Here is how DR really works and how to raise it without spam.
What Domain Rating is, and what it is not
DR is not a Google metric. It does not directly rank your pages. It is a proxy created by SEO tools to summarize the strength of your backlink profile. Still, it has real-world value because it correlates with the same signals that help pages rank and with how people vet your site.
Where DR helps:
- Outreach acceptance. Many publishers and partners use DR cutoffs to filter pitches.
- Competitive benchmarking. Tracking DR over time against competitors shows if your authority is compounding or stalling.
- Referral quality hint. A higher DR usually reflects a healthier mix of credible, unique referring domains.
Where DR misleads:
- Vanity goals. Traffic, conversions, and indexation health come first. DR is a leading indicator, not the finish line.
- Any-link chasing. Irrelevant or low-quality links waste crawl budget and can erode trust signals.
- Ignoring technicals. If important pages are unindexed, canonicalized incorrectly, or orphaned, link equity does not flow well.
How DR works in practice
Every tool has its own formula, but the mechanics are consistent enough to guide a plan:
- Unique referring domains drive the score. Ten links from ten different sites usually beat one hundred links from a single site.
- Stronger sites pass more weight. A contextual link from a trusted publication can outweigh dozens of links from weak directories.
- Placement and context matter. In-content editorial links on crawlable pages beat footer, sidebar, or bio-only links.
- Outlinks dilute equity. A link on a page that links to 200 other sites passes less share than one on a tightly edited page.
- The scale is logarithmic. Going from DR 10 to 20 is much easier than going from 60 to 70. Each step up needs disproportionately more and better links.
- Freshness and loss count. If a linking page deletes or nofollows your link, or the linking site loses authority, your DR can dip even if you change nothing.
Simple example: if Site A at DR 70 links to your guide from a focused article with 20 total outlinks, that single link can move the needle more than twenty directory listings at DR 10. Add five more unique DR 40 to DR 50 links over a month and you will often see a noticeable bump, especially if you started below DR 30.
Real-world ways DR moves
Local service business
A regional HVAC firm earns three new referring domains in a quarter: a chamber of commerce feature, a safety checklist guest post on a reputable home improvement blog, and a manufacturer case study. DR rises because each is unique, relevant, and editorial. Ten extra thin citations on random directories do almost nothing.
SaaS startup
A B2B SaaS publishes teardown posts and honest comparison pages that include competitors. They pitch niche newsletters and partner blogs. One contextual mention from a respected industry publication plus a handful of new niche domains lifts DR quickly. Reciprocal sidebar swaps do not budge it.
Ecommerce with suppliers
An online retailer builds evergreen product education pages and offers original photos and specs. Several brands update their where-to-buy pages with in-content links to those resources. Each unique supplier domain helps. Rewriting thin product blurbs into thorough guides increases the chance of being cited elsewhere.

Multilingual brand
A multinational site localizes cornerstone guides into Spanish and French with correct hreflang. Regional publishers in Spain and Canada link to the localized pages. DR improves through country-specific referring domains, and the localized content ranks locally, compounding reach.
